The Defense Committee of the House of Commons of the British Parliament released the report “British Defense and the Indo-Pacific Region” on the 24th, examining the “leaning towards the Indo-Pacific” defense policy promoted by the British government. The report requires the British government to face up to China’s aggressive intentions towards Taiwan and its strategic threats to the international order. The report also requires the British government and armed forces to coordinate with partner countries to develop response plans for a series of possible Chinese actions against Taiwan, and to make regular confidential reports to the Defense Committee of the House of Commons.

my country’s Ministry of Foreign Affairs stated that Taiwan was mentioned as many as 40 times in this report, citing the remarks of my country’s Foreign Minister Joseph Wu, and mentioning that China may use force against Taiwan in 2027, which fully proves that the British Parliament attaches great importance to the Taiwan Strait issue.

The British government released the “Comprehensive Review Report on Foreign, Defense and Security Policy” for the first time in 2021, proposing an “Indo-Pacific Tilt” defense policy line, and proposed an updated version this year; the Defense Committee of the House of Commons of the British Parliament also proposed in 2022 A monitoring plan was launched in January of this year to monitor the effectiveness of policy implementation on a regular basis.

The Defense Committee of the British House of Commons released the “UK Defense and the Indo-Pacific” report on the 24th. In addition to proposing a phased review of the situation, it also supports the British government in positioning China as an “epoch-making institutional challenge.” (epoch-defining and systemic challenge), and requires the government to face up to China’s aggressive intentions towards Taiwan and the long-term strategic threats to the international order.

The report also mentioned the potential cross-strait conflict, which has become the primary concern of Western countries in the Indo-Pacific region in recent years. The article also quoted Wu Zhaoxie’s interview with the British “Guardian” in April this year, saying that China may use force against Taiwan in 2027. , Taiwan has prepared for possible conflict situations.

The report also pays attention to the possibility of Taiwan suffering from an economic blockade or a gray zone hybrid attack, and emphasizes that Taiwan supplies nearly 92% of the world’s advanced chips, and 48% of the world’s container ships will pass through the Taiwan Strait in the first half of 2022; once a conflict or blockade occurs, it will impact on the global and UK economies. The Defense Committee hereby urges the British government to work with the United States, France and regional allies and partners to develop response plans for possible aggressive actions by China against Taiwan. The report mentions Taiwan as many as 40 times, making it the focus of Indo-Pacific policy.

The Ministry of Foreign Affairs stated that after the British government announced the “Integrated Policy Review Update” in March this year, the British Parliament has also successively issued relevant reports, including the “Tilted Horizon” issued by the Foreign Affairs Committee of the House of Commons in August, continuing to demonstrate its commitment to peace across the Taiwan Strait. and stable attention and support. The Ministry of Foreign Affairs emphasized that Taiwan will strengthen cooperation with the United Kingdom and global partners with similar ideas to jointly safeguard economic security, democratic resilience, and an international order of peace and prosperity.
